Amundi Appoints New Investor Relations Head

The recently enlarged European asset manager has filled the role vacated by its investor relations head.

Amundi has appointed Anthony Mellor as head of investor relations and financial communication, replacing Cyril Meilland, who is joining Crédit Agricole as head of financial communication.

Based in Paris, Mellor started his career as a parliamentary attaché and held various financial positions at Air Liquide and AGF Asset Management (now Allianz Global Investors). In 2002, he joined the Bouygues Group, where he spent eight years in senior finance and investor relations roles. He joined Lagardère Group in 2010 as chief of investor relations.

The appointment follows that of Bruno Taillardat, who joined Amundi earlier this month in the newly-created role of head of smart beta.

As at the end of June 2016, Paris-headquartered Amundi had assets under management of over €1 trillion ($1.1 trillion) worldwide. It recently took an 87.5 per cent stake in Dublin-based asset management boutique Kleinwort Benson Investors, which was subsequently rebranded as KBI Global Investors to reflect the increasingly international scope of its business. Meanwhile, Amundi plans to boost its assets under management by around €5 billion by merging its real estate business with that of Crédit Agricole Immobilier, as reported in WealthBriefing today.
